HIGH VOLTAGE PROJECT

Stewart Center

Schedule | Milestones | Photos

Schedule:

  • Construction phase: January 7 to April 18, 2008

Milestones:

  • SHUTDOWN, December 27: The electrical service to STEW will be shutdown on Thursday, December 27, 2007, at 6:00 p.m. for three to six hours. This shutdown will enable crews to connect the buildings to the mobile substations, which will be used for the duration of the High Voltage upgrades at STEW.
  • The high voltage project begins January 7 and is expected to be complete by April 18, 2008. The following conditions will affect dock access at Stewart during this time:
    • The high voltage project will have two fenced areas on the north side of STEW. One will be on the east side of the loading dock, around the high voltage vault, and the second will be an approximately 10-12' wide area running from the loading dock back to the manhole, adjacent to the ramp on the west side of the dock. This fencing will contain two mobile substations, as well as the high voltage cables running from the manhole to the mobile subs.
    • High voltage project contractors will be parked alongside the fenced vault area, or inside this fencing.
    • The 4th floor library renovation project's dumpster will remain in place at the end of the ramp, on the west side of the loading dock.
    • Space will be allotted between this dumpster and the fenced area to allow ramp access for golf carts.
    • The trash compactor will be remain available, with the exception of a day or two when it will need to be shutdown for re-wiring. This trash compactor will be relocated to the west of yellow poles as it was last summer. 
    • Space between the trash compactor and the fenced mobile substations should be sufficient to accommodate two trucks at a time for loading/unloading. The elevator will be accessible.

Due to these conditions, parking and access at the dock is be very limited.

  • Feb. 27: The existing transformers hae been removed. The new tranformer and concrete pads are being installed, and the vaults will be painted. In the next two weeks, new switch gear and bus duct will be installed. The project is proceeding on schedule at this time.
  • March 14: Two new transfomers were damaged when being transported to the new vaults. The project's completion may be delayed.
  • March 19: Crews are working on the installation of the following: transformer pad, primary conduit, switch gear, and bus duct. The damaged transformers are being repaired at the manufacturer. STEW will remain connected to the mobile substations until the new transformers arrive.
  • March 26: Installation of primary conduit and bus duct is nearing completion. Grounding in the vault is being terminated. In the next two weeks, lighting in the vault will be installed, and medium voltage cables will be terminated and tested.
  • April 9: A failed connector in one of the mobile subs failed yesterday, causing a temporary power outage at STEW and other campus buildings. The mobile sub was repaired that night. See photos below.
  • April 30: The repaired transformers have arrived and been installed. Other work with cables and busduct is being finalized. A switchover to the new permanent power supply is expected to take place in the next two weeks, pending scheduling concerns.
  • SHUTDOWN, May 23: The electrical service to STEW and HIKS will be shutdown on Friday, May 23, 2008, at 5:30pm and last 3-6 hours. This shutdown is required to make the transition back to normal power from the temporary substations.
